Output 00702376254adf7556c785a86e1afb2fbcb2f89927625bf8cf231405093836e8:0

value
128326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c886fa5b745c1126e34d6b732245104dd27b9557 OP_EQUAL
address
3KyJmLqLtRdNTgauPcT1vGJToPqXL1AdCV
transaction
00702376254adf7556c785a86e1afb2fbcb2f89927625bf8cf231405093836e8
confirmations
222555
spent
true